- W4310366957 abstract "This chapter focuses on the two fundamental goals associated with functional genomics, namely, monitoring overall changes in gene expression through standard laboratory procedures, and using bioinformatics, specifically homology searches, to predict gene function from the actual DNA sequence. Functional genomics is all about a holistic assessment of genome behavior with a focus on a global analysis of gene expression, rather than focusing on the behavior of one or a few genes. As structure directs function, it is important to understand that, while the genome is static in the sense that the semiconservative manner in which DNA is replicated ensures genetic continuity, the genome is subject to mutation and somatic recombination which can change the function of one or more genes. The ability to measure PCR product accumulation in real-time has added great value to the study of gene expression by examining RNA as one parameter of gene expression. Other contemporary approaches include CRISPR, a method for precision editing of genes, and RNA-seq, for whole transcriptome sequencing. The term “transcriptomics” is used to refer to assessing changes in the abundance of RNA in an experimental context, though “functional genomics” is a more inclusive term. Other commonly used functional genomics approaches are microarray analysis, aptamers, nanobiotechnology, gene transfer, PCR, or polymerase chain reaction, RNAi, SAGE, bioinformatics, epigenetics, two-dimensional gel electrophoresis, protein arrays, mass spectrometry, and metabolomics, as well as classical genetic mapping." @default.
